Warning Signs You Need Water Damage Assessment
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ent safety hazards. Here are some war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of hidden moisture or mold growth. Don’t ignore it, it’s a warning sign.
Warped or Discolored Flooring or Walls
Visible signs of water damage, such as warping or discoloration, can show a more serious issue. Don’t wait until it’s too late.
Leaks or Water Stains
Leaks or water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a hidden issue. Don’t try to fix it yourself, call a pro.
Unexplained Mold Growth
Mold growth can be a sign of hidden moisture or water damage. Don’t risk your health, get it checked out.
Unusual Noises or Sounds
Unusual noises or sounds, such as dripping or gurgling, can show a hidden issue. Don’t ignore it, it’s a warning sign.
Water Damage Assessment v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ak in a single room | Yes | No | Easy to fix with basic tools and materials. |
| Hidden moisture or mold growth | No | Yes | Needs specialized equipment and expertise to detect and fix. |
| Widespread water damage or flooding | No | Yes | Needs professional equipment and expertise to assess and repair. |
| Unknown source of water damage | No | Yes | Needs professional investigation to find out the cause and fix it. |
| Structural damage or safety hazards | No | Yes | Needs professional expertise to assess and repair safely. |
| Insurance claim or documentation | No | Yes | Needs professional documentation and expertise to ensure a successful claim. |
